Description

The On-site Technical Trainer is responsible for designing, developing, and delivering engaging training programs that enable adult learners to effectively use and support technical systems.

This role:
  • Combines expertise in instructional design, content development, and virtual facilitation to create scalable, high-impact learning solutions.
  • Partners with technical teams and stakeholders to translate complex system functionality into clear, user-friendly training experiences that drive adoption, proficiency, and performance.
  • Tracks all program personnel certifications to ensure annual certification requirements are met and that staff maintain comprehensive and current knowledge within their respective disciplines.
  • Documents, retains, and tracks required staff training and ensures compliance with established training frequency requirements.


Primary Job Responsibilities
  • Design and develop comprehensive training curricula for technical systems, including virtual instructor-led training (VILT), eLearning modules, and self-paced learning solutions
  • Apply adult learning principles and instructional design methodologies (e.g., ADDIE, SAM) to create effective, learner-centered content
  • Translate complex technical concepts, workflows, and system processes into clear, engaging training materials
  • Develop a wide range of learning assets, including facilitator guides, user manuals, job aids, simulations, videos, and knowledge base content
  • Deliver interactive virtual training sessions using modern learning technologies and engagement strategies
  • Conduct training needs analyses to identify knowledge gaps and align learning solutions with business and system requirements
  • Collaborate with subject matter experts, developers, and program teams to ensure accuracy and relevance of technical content
  • Evaluate training effectiveness through assessments, learner feedback, and performance metrics; continuously refine content
  • Support system implementations, upgrades, and enhancements by developing and delivering targeted training programs
  • Maintain and update training materials to reflect system changes, new features, and evolving best practices
  • Track training completion and learner progress through a training platform.

Securing Your Data

Beware of fake employment opportunities using Leidos’ name. Leidos will never ask you to provide payment-related information during any part of the employment application process (i.e., ask you for money), nor will Leidos ever advance money as part of the hiring process (i.e., send you a check or money order before doing any work). Further, Leidos will only communicate with you through emails that are generated by the Leidos.com automated system – never from free commercial services (e.g., Gmail, Yahoo, Hotmail) or via WhatsApp, Telegram, etc. If you received an email purporting to be from Leidos that asks for payment-related information or any other personal information (e.g., about you or your previous employer), and you are concerned about its legitimacy, please make us aware immediately by emailing us at LeidosCareersFraud@leidos.com .

If you believe you are the victim of a scam, contact your local law enforcement and report the incident to the U.S. Federal Trade Commission .
